Drywall Renovation in Denver County, CO
Drywall renovation services involve updating, repairing, or replacing existing drywall surfaces within a property. This type of project typically includes activities such as patching holes, smoothing out surface imperfections, installing new drywall panels, or creating seamless finishes for walls and ceilings. Homeowners often seek drywall renovation when preparing a space for painting, remodeling a room, or fixing damage caused by moisture, impact, or age. These services are suitable for both minor touch-ups and larger projects that require significant wall or ceiling updates.

Common Drywall Renovation Jobs
Drywall Repair - restores damaged or cracked drywall to a smooth, seamless surface.
Drywall Installation - replaces outdated or damaged walls with new drywall for a fresh look.
Texturing and Finishing - adds texture or smooth finishes to match existing wall styles.
Water Damage Restoration - repairs drywall affected by leaks or flooding to prevent mold growth.
Soundproofing Projects - installs or upgrades drywall to improve room acoustics and privacy.
Fire-Resistant Drywall - enhances safety with specialized drywall for kitchens and utility areas.
Drywall Renovation Questions
What types of drywall renovation projects are common? Typical projects include patching damaged walls, finishing new drywall, and updating textured surfaces for a fresh look.
How can drywall renovation improve a property’s interior? It can enhance the appearance of walls, repair damage, and prepare surfaces for painting or decorating.
Is drywall renovation suitable for both interior and exterior spaces? Drywall renovation is primarily for interior spaces; exterior surfaces require different materials and methods.
What should homeowners consider before starting drywall renovation? Assessing the extent of damage or updates needed helps determine the best approach for a smooth finish.
